Christmas has come early in the form of a wonderfully festive book from No.1 bestselling author Tracy Bloom. Following on from No-One Ever Has Sex on a Tuesday and No-One Ever Has Sex in the Suburbs, No One Ever Has Sex on Christmas Day is published today by Bookouture. Anyone who has dealt with a family Christmas knows the politics and stress that goes into such a celebration, but Katy and Ben are determined to make theirs a day to remember…

 

Katy’s been stuck in the office away from her family so she wants it all: snow (fake or real), the Michael Bublé Christmas album, whatever it takes. There’s only one thing missing as far as her husband Ben is concerned: another baby to complete their family. But Katy isn’t so sure she’s ready yet.

 

Ben may be playing the role of Master Elf in the pre-school nativity but he is struggling to master his own family life. With romantically-challenged friends, an ex who refuses to go away and Katy’s mum’s 64-year-old toy boy thrown into the mix, Christmas looks like it could be going off the rails… Never mind family planning, can Katy and Ben even plan to make it to the end of Christmas Day?
